什么是CDN,如何才能加速?
CDN 的全称是 Content Delivery Network,即内容分发网络。CDN 是一种通过分布在全球各地的缓存服务器,将用户的请求导向最近的缓存服务器,从而加速用户访问的技术。

要加速 CDN,可以采取以下几种方法:
1. 选择合适的 CDN 服务提供商:不同的 CDN 服务提供商的加速效果可能会有所不同,因此需要选择一家信誉良好、服务稳定、价格合理的 CDN 服务提供商。
2. 优化网站内容:对网站内容进行优化,包括压缩文件大小、使用缓存、减少图片和视频的使用等,可以减少网站的加载时间,从而提高 CDN 的加速效果。

3. 合理配置缓存服务器:CDN 缓存服务器的配置需要根据实际情况进行合理配置,包括缓存服务器的数量、位置、负载均衡等,以确保最佳的加速效果。
4. 使用智能 DNS:智能 DNS 可以将用户的请求导向最优的服务器,从而提高加速效果。
5. 定期进行性能监测:定期对 CDN 的加速效果进行监测,包括访问速度、响应时间、可用性等,以便及时发现和解决问题,进一步提高加速效果。

总之,通过选择合适的 CDN 服务提供商、优化网站内容、合理配置缓存服务器、使用智能 DNS 以及定期进行性能监测等方法,可以有效地加速 CDN,提高用户访问速度和网站的可用性。
CDN中文意思即为内容分发网络,它其实是边缘计算的一种。消息内容通过网络传输有很大的延迟,举个例子:服务器在北京,用户在深圳,那么用户访问服务器来回需要几百毫秒了。在计算机世界,几百毫秒算是很大的延迟了。那么程序员就想,可不可以把用户要的内容先放到深圳去,这样子用户就是本地访问内容了,延迟可能就两三毫秒!这是巨大的进步!
把内容从北京拷贝到深圳,是一种服务端自己完成的,用户无感知。所以CDN技术是服务端技术!
国内提供CDN的厂商有很多,比如大家都知道的阿里云、腾讯云、aws等等。最高、最贵的厂商是网宿科技,苹果就用的他家的,如appstore软件分发!很多公有云产商或多或少也基于他家提供服务!你可以买网宿科技的股票,算科技股中很有潜力的!
CDN的全称是Content Delivery Network,即内容分发网络。其基本思路是尽可能避开互联网上有可能影响数据传输速度和稳定性的瓶颈和环节,使内容传输的更快、更稳定。
简单的来说,就是把原服务器上数据复制到其他服务器上,用户访问时,那台服务器近访问到的就是那台服务器上的数据。CDN加速优点是成本低,速度快。适合访问量比较大的网站。
CDN能几乎涵盖国内所有线路。而在可靠性上, CDN 在结构上实现了多点的冗余,即使某一个节点由于意外发生故障,对网站的访问能够被自动导向其他的健康节点进行响应。CDN能轻松实现网站的全国铺设,不必考虑服务器的投入与托管、不必考虑新增带宽的成本、不必考虑多台服务器的镜像同步、不必考虑更多的管理维护技术人员。
CDN加速的过程分析:
如果我们以2Mbps的服务器带宽计算。理论速度为256kb/s的速度,那么加载完成20M的网页需要多久呢?全速理论最快也要80s才能完成首页的加载,而且这是最快的理论值速度,请求数过多实际会超过100s,这个绝对是无法忍受的,谁会等待2分钟,就为了看一眼你的首页?
使用了CDN加速之后,速度提升到3-4s左右!这个速度的提升还是非常明显的,我们再次计算这个时候的带宽大约达到了40Mbps,总结起来,CDN加速并不是万能的,我们网站速度的提升和优化是多方面多手段的,除非你的速度限制和瓶颈刚好在这里,那么使用了CDN就会突飞猛进的提升。
所以说使用CDN加速功能的主机/服务器可以快速的带动网站的访问速度,像BlueHost中文站提供的虚拟主机就带有全球CDN加速功能,访问速度很快,而且还带有无限流量和空间,支持无限建站,性价比很高。
到此,以上就是小编对于cdn加速是啥的问题就介绍到这了,希望这1点解答对大家有用。